Nissan Of Windsor-198760

Car Repair Shops in Windsor, Ontario, Canada

Nissan of Windsor

Street: 9760 Tecumseh Road East
City: Windsor
Province: Ontario
Postal Code: N8R 1A2
Country: Canada
Phone: +15197357744
Rating: 3.5
Category: Car Repair, Car Dealers, Auto Repair
Nissan of Windsor is located at 9760 Tecumseh Road East

More Car Repair Shops within 2 Kilometres

The following 8 Car Repair Shops have been found within 2 Kilometres

Search by location:

Search by category: